How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Allen County?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Allen County Studio Apartments | $980 | $525 | $1,710 |
Allen County 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,171 | $514 | $4,045 |
Allen County 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,453 | $619 | $3,959 |
Allen County 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,816 | $539 | $4,863 |
Allen County 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,759 | $600 | $2,495 |
